About the Book

This book is a compilation of selected papers presented during the 25th Scientific Conference Microscopy Society Malaysia held in Bangi, Malaysia on 7th to the 9th of December 2016. This book shows the key role of microscopy and other various analytical techniques in the modern materials science including for the research of metals, ceramics, polymers, composites, nanomaterials and biomaterials. All contributions in this book concentrated around materials with properties and applications that may aid in solving pressing global issues such as environment, pollution, energy and biomedicine.
